*Congress Comes to House with Pre-Decided Agenda, Relies on False Claims and Allegations – Chief Minister*

*No Opposition Member Is Stopped from Entering the House or Insulted, Says Sh. Nayab Singh Saini*

Posted On: 27 Aug 2026 3:19PM

Chandigarh, August 27 – Haryana Chief Minister Sh. Nayab Singh Saini on Thursday said that the Congress comes to the House with a pre-decided agenda and remains unwilling to listen to facts. Strongly rejecting the Congress's allegations that its members are stopped from entering the House and subjected to humiliation, the Chief Minister clarified that neither the Leader of the Opposition nor any other Opposition member was stopped from entering the House or insulted. All members are allowed to enter the House with due respect.

 

The Chief Minister, while responding on the first day of the Monsoon Session of the Haryana Vidhan Sabha to allegations made by the Leader of the Opposition, Sh. Bhupinder Singh Hooda and Dr. Raghuvir Singh Kadian that they were stopped from entering the House and pushed, calling the allegations completely false.

 

Sh. Nayab Singh Saini said it is unfortunate that the Congress is not prepared to listen to anything in the House. He further said that the party has already decided its agenda and is levelling allegations accordingly. He further said it is also very unfortunate that the Congress has made its senior leaders wear black clothes, remarking that they are not at an age to be made to wear such attire.

 

The Chief Minister reiterated that no one misbehaves with the Congress members and that they were allowed to enter the House with full respect. He said that falsehood is always part of the Congress's agenda, adding that its leaders make false statements and level allegations, and that this is all they have to offer.

 

*Video Footage Will Bring Out the Truth; Congress Misleading the House with False Allegations – Chief Minister*

 

The Chief Minister further said that he has gathered complete information about the incident and the Opposition's claims in the House that its members were hurt or subjected to any kind of mistreatment are completely false.

 

He suggested that the Vidhan Sabha Speaker can call members from both the ruling party and the Opposition to his chamber and have the relevant video footage examined. He said the footage will establish the facts and clarify the entire situation.

 

*People of Haryana Are Watching What Is Right and What Is Wrong; Let the House Function Smoothly – Chief Minister*

 

The Chief Minister said that the House should be allowed to function smoothly, as the people of Haryana are watching everything. Urging the Vidhan Sabha Speaker to ensure discussion in the House, he said that this August House is meant for discussion and debate, and if any member has an issue, it can be raised for discussion, and the government will respond to it. However, the kind of uproar being created is neither appropriate for the Opposition nor in keeping with the dignity of the House.

 

The Chief Minister said that the people of Haryana are watching everything and are well aware of what is right and what is wrong. They have seen the tenure of the Opposition and are also witnessing the governance under the leadership of Prime Minister Sh. Narendra Modi.
